Screening of differentially expressed genes and their prognostic value in pancreatic cancer:Bioinformatics analysis

Abstract:Objective:To provide theoretical basis for the diagnosis and targeted therapy of pancreatic ductal adenocarcinoma(PDAC),we excavated the hub genes of PDAC and investigated the expression and prognostic value via bioinformatics analysis.Methods:Gene chip data GSE16515,GSE28735,GSE62452 and TCGA-GTEx were downloaded from GEO and TCGA databases,respectively,then we found common differential expressed genes through R software.GO enrichment analysis and KEGG pathway analysis were conducted,and protein-protein interaction(PPI)Network was constructed to screen hub genes,and finally we verified the expression of hub genes in PDAC and their prognostic value of PDAC.Results:A total of 219 DEGs were identified,of which 139 were up-regulated and 80 were down-regulated.Finally,a total of 10 key genes associated PDAC were screened,among which FN1,POSTN,VCAN,MMP1,EGF,and ALB were significantly related to the poor prognosis of PDAC(P<0.05).VCAN combined with ALB,MMP1 and POSTN had a higher value in predicting the survival and prognosis of PDAC.Conclusion:The five hub genes are significantly related to the prognosis of PDAC unearthed from the public biological database,which provides a theoretical basis for future research on the pathogenesis,clinical diagnosis and treatment targets of PDAC.
